Emir of Ilorin Confers Sardauna Title on Governor AbdulRazaq

Date: 2024-08-30

As reported by This Day, the Emir of Ilorin and Chairman of the Kwara State Traditional Council of Chiefs, Alhaji Ibrahim Sulu-Gambari, has conferred the title of Sardauna of Ilorin on the state governor and Chairman of Nigeria's Governors Forum (NGF), Alhaji AbdulRahman AbdulRazaq.

The Emir stated that the conferment of the title on Governor AbdulRazaq was in recognition of his deep love for, and significant investment in, the culture and traditions of Nigeria's southernmost Emirate.

This honour makes Governor AbdulRazaq the second person to hold the title of Sardauna of Ilorin, following the death of Alhaji Umaru Saro.

Speaking at the brief ceremony held in Ilorin on Thursday, the Emir praised AbdulRazaq for his exemplary leadership qualities and his unwavering commitment to promoting the interests of the Ilorin community, including his unmatched support for the Durbar festival.

The Emir also commended the governor for his outstanding leadership both at the state level and on the national stage as Chairman of the NGF.

He said: “I am convinced that Governor AbdulRazaq is not only popular, but he also believes in and promotes our tradition and custom.

“He (governor) made sure he participated actively in the annual Ilorin Grand Durbar. So he deserves the honour of a chieftaincy title to do more.

“For this reason and by my prerogative power, I confer on you the Sardauna of Ilorin from today.”

According to the monarch, “In our long-standing practices, one of the prominent qualities we always consider before conferring chieftaincy titles is popularity.

“We usually consider whether or not such a person is famous within his immediate community and beyond.

“From all indications, Governor AbdulRazaq is popular both at home and abroad, and widely celebrated, to the extent of being chosen as Chairman of the Nigeria Governors' Forum.”

The emir described AbdulRazaq as a lover and promoter of peace, an attribute he noted is responsible for the governor's continued progress.

“Let us be thankful to God that we are gifted this kind of governor. Despite all forms of security challenges across the country, Kwara has been relatively peaceful.

“We must give credit to the God Almighty who accepts our prayers, and to the governor for encouraging peace. “That is why he has been progressive and he will continue to progress,” he added.

Responding, AbdulRazaq thanked the emir for the traditional title, which he said is an encouragement to do more for the community and the people.

He said: “On the conferment of the Sardauna of Ilorin title, it is said that it is not an ordinary title, going by the antecedents of those who have occupied the position across Nigeria.

“We are truly grateful and this encourages us to do more for our communities. Thank you very much indeed, Your Royal Highness.”

The governor commended the emir and other traditional rulers for maintaining peace and stability in their domains, saying the Northern Nigeria Governors' Forum believes that constitutional roles be given to the traditional rulers in the country.

“Today's visit was to thank the traditional council personalised by his Royal Highness, the Emir of Ilorin, and to also thank him for the peace we enjoy during the protest across Nigeria,” the governor said
